The Chinese new year

In Paris, three parades must be held for the occasion.

The first parade, also called “Spring Festival”, will normally take place on Friday, February  the 16th in the 3rd and 4th districts of Paris. The start of the parade with dragons, lions, dancers and tanks should be given at 2PM at the Republic Square, after the famous opening ceremony of the eye of the Dragon. The city should offer many cultural activities around the Chinese New Year.

The second parade should take place the following week in the 13th district of Paris (the parisian Chinatown). The procession usually leaves around 1:30PM from Avenue d’Ivry and then follows the following way: Avenue de Choisy, Place d’Italie, Avenue d’Italie, rue de Tolbiac, Avenue de Choisy, Boulevard Massena, Avenue d’Ivry. Every year, more than 100,000 people come to parade to the rhythm of Chinese folk dances. Here again, the 13th district organizes two cultural weeks around the Chinese New Year.

As the previous years, a third Chinese New Year parade is also scheduled to take place in the Belleville district of Paris  (the 11th), the 10th, the 20th and the 19th districts. The departure should be given to the Belleville metro at 10:30.
